The Shelf2Life History of the American South Collection is a group of unique pre-1923 books that examine the people and events that shaped this region of the United States.  From the rise of slavery on farms and plantations to the rejuvenated demand for tobacco and cotton, many of these volumes focus on the intense changes experienced in the antebellum South.  Significant attention is given to the politics of the early 19th century, thus offering readers a broad overview of the events that lead to the Civil War and eventual destruction of the South.  The Shelf2Life History of the American South Collections provides insight into the controversial political and economic beliefs of notable southern leaders and citizens and the struggles they faced with reconstruction.
